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2277 00918036 76745825 8142
77383 05
77383 05
755568 68 527775660
All about undefined
Interested in learning more?
77383 05
755568 68 527775660
See more
5077670119 0214761 015
7792127 55 699063
See more
07856033 71474
7433995926 11026 44688621137
See more